NARCOTICS DIVISION

 

IMG_2490.jpg

 

The Madison County Sheriff’s Office Narcotics Division is responsible for detecting, investigating and prosecuting those persons that violate the laws in regards to illegal narcotics. This includes production, manufacturing, distribution, transportation and chronic use of illegal drugs; and the associated money laundering of drug proceeds commonly associated with drug/gang related offenses.

Investigators assigned to this unit are highly skilled and trained in the techniques used to fight illegal drug trafficking and abuse. Narcotics Investigators make undercover purchases, controlled purchases, conduct reverse operations and stings, and conduct surveillance as well as gather intelligence. The investigators assigned to this division work closely with federal, state and local agencies to combat drug trafficking in our county.

From the most complex workings of the major narcotics traffickers to the methods and operations of the street level dealer, the Sheriff’s Narcotics Division actively and aggressively pursues all violators in a manner which helps to promote that our neighborhoods are free from the fear of crime.
